The Opportunity
We are looking for an experienced CSA Quantity Surveyor to join our project team in the UK. The successful applicant will work closely with the project leadership team and wider Commercial department to ensure the successful delivery of the project for our clients and stakeholders.
Key Tasks
- Provide commercial and contractual administration support to the Commercial Manager.
- Undertaking internal valuations and production of cost reports.
- Supporting the management of applicable subcontract packages and overseeing payments to subcontractors, suppliers and consultants.
- Preparing remeasures and variations for submission and follow on agreement with our clients.
- Reporting on project budgets and variations.
- Distribute and track invoices to various project owners/leads for approval.
- Respond to and resolve enquiries from Suppliers, Procurement, and Finance departments (including monthly accruals) in a professional and timely manner.
Key Qualifications Required:
- A CSA or tertiary qualification in Quantity Surveying, Engineering, or a similar field.
- A minimum of 3 years of post-graduate experience in the construction sector.
- Strong analytical skills and ability to clearly present findings.
- High level of computer literacy, with experience using relevant estimating software.
- Good communication skills for internal and external liaison.
- Ability to achieve demanding time and quality targets.
- Meticulous approach to take-offs and pricing to ensure accuracy.
